Thirty Iranian ships sunk in seven days

3 min read
13:17UTC

More than 30 vessels sunk or destroyed since 28 February. Iran's 65-ship surface fleet is functionally halved — the most concentrated naval destruction since the Second World War.

More than 30 Iranian naval vessels have been sunk or destroyed since strikes began on 28 February, according to CENTCOM figures confirmed by Admiral Brad Cooper. Iran's surface fleet before the war comprised approximately 65 operational vessels. Half are now gone. The confirmed losses include the IRIS Shahid Bagheri drone carrier, the IRIS Dena — sunk by a US submarine torpedo south of Sri Lanka, the first American torpedo kill since 1945 — and the IRIS Shahid Sayyad Shirazi and an unnamed Jamaran-class corvette, both filmed ablaze at their berths in Chah Bahar . The IRIS Bushehr, the Dena's sister ship, is now interned in Sri Lanka. Two drone carriers confirmed destroyed. The number of individually identified vessels — by name, class, or visual confirmation — now approaches a dozen. The gap between that figure and the Pentagon's 30+ claim remains unverified, though the scale of strikes on port infrastructure makes high totals plausible.

The toll has escalated from the 20 warships Defence Secretary Hegseth claimed on Day 5 , a figure that drew scepticism because only the IRIS Dena had been independently verified at that point. The last time a state navy suffered losses of this magnitude in this compressed a timeframe was arguably the Second World War itself. In the 1982 Falklands War, Argentina lost approximately six vessels over 74 days. Iran has lost more than 30 in seven. In Operation Praying Mantis in April 1988 — the last direct US-Iran naval confrontation — Iran lost two frigates.

What has been destroyed is three decades of conventional naval modernisation. Iran began building indigenous frigates and corvettes in the early 2000s, part of a broader effort to develop a navy capable of contesting the Persian Gulf beyond the IRGC Navy's traditional small-boat swarming tactics. The Moudge-class frigates, Jamaran-class corvettes, and the drone carriers represented Tehran's attempt to operate as a conventional naval power. That programme is now functionally over. Iran's remaining maritime capability defaults to what the IRGC Navy was originally designed for when it was established during the Iran-Iraq War: fast attack craft, mines, and coastal anti-ship missiles — asymmetric tools for area denial rather than power projection. The conventional capabilities destroyed this week took three decades to build. The posture Iran reverts to is the one it started with in 1980.

Root Causes

Iran's surface fleet was structurally exposed because three decades of US and international sanctions prevented acquisition of modern integrated air defence systems for its ships, leaving them without the layered protection that would have raised the cost of US strikes. This is a vulnerability that predates the conflict by thirty years and was identified in open literature — Iran's decision to retain and deploy the fleet despite this known weakness remains analytically unexplained.
